Transaction 64b7adde1633e53724d32f347bed045ea1ac06e02c1b16624f58f36e1fd8d6da

1 Input
2 Outputs
  • 64b7adde1633e53724d32f347bed045ea1ac06e02c1b16624f58f36e1fd8d6da:0
  • value  1265838491
    address  3CPizmJAgknVWWw1cR41e4GLp6ioG9VjWi
  • 64b7adde1633e53724d32f347bed045ea1ac06e02c1b16624f58f36e1fd8d6da:1
  • value  610453
    address  32fpYd4wwrVKX4rTKwdKS64n3J3TcEjUu5